Modern Dodge vehicles rely heavily on their batteries to power essential systems, from starting the engine to supporting electronic features. However, vibrations from driving conditions can impact the longevity of these batteries, leading to unexpected failures and costly replacements.
How Vibrations Affect Battery Life
Vibrations are mechanical oscillations that occur when a vehicle is in motion. In Dodge cars, especially those driven on rough roads or off-road terrains, these vibrations can cause internal damage to the battery. Over time, this damage can lead to decreased capacity, increased internal resistance, and ultimately, battery failure.
Internal Damage and Corrosion
Repeated vibrations can cause the internal plates of a battery to shift or crack. This internal movement can lead to increased corrosion and the formation of deposits, which hinder the flow of electricity. As a result, the battery struggles to hold a charge and may fail prematurely.
Connection Loosening
Vibrations can also loosen the battery terminals and connections. Loose connections can cause intermittent power supply issues, making it difficult for the vehicle to start or operate electronic systems properly. Over time, this can further damage the battery and related components.
Preventive Measures to Protect Your Dodge Battery
- Ensure Proper Mounting: Use vibration-dampening mounts or pads designed for automotive batteries.
- Regular Inspection: Check battery terminals and connections periodically for tightness and corrosion.
- Avoid Rough Terrain: When possible, drive cautiously on uneven roads to reduce excessive vibrations.
- Maintain Battery Health: Keep the battery charged and replace it when signs of wear appear.
